Add latest changes from gitlab-org/gitlab@master
This commit is contained in:
parent
8e211be724
commit
077a0d707f
|
|
@ -33,13 +33,18 @@ On self-managed GitLab, by default [migrating group items](#migrated-group-items
|
|||
feature, ask an administrator to [enable it in application settings](../../admin_area/settings/visibility_and_access_controls.md#enable-migration-of-groups-and-projects-by-direct-transfer).
|
||||
Also on self-managed GitLab, by default [migrating project items](#migrated-project-items) is not available. To show
|
||||
this feature, ask an administrator to [enable the feature flag](../../../administration/feature_flags.md) named
|
||||
`bulk_import_projects`. The feature is not ready for production use. On GitLab.com, migration of both groups and projects
|
||||
is available.
|
||||
`bulk_import_projects`. The feature is not ready for production use. On GitLab.com, migration of both groups and projects is available.
|
||||
|
||||
WARNING:
|
||||
When you migrate a group to GitLab.com, all its subgroups and projects are migrated too. This feature is in [Beta](../../../policy/alpha-beta-support.md#beta-features) and not ready for production use.
|
||||
On self-managed GitLab, migrating project items is not available by default. To show
|
||||
this Beta feature, ask an administrator to [enable the feature flag](../../../administration/feature_flags.md) named
|
||||
`bulk_import_projects`.
|
||||
|
||||
Prerequisites:
|
||||
|
||||
- Network connection between instances or GitLab.com. Must support HTTPS.
|
||||
- Both GitLab instances have migration enabled in application settings by instance administrator.
|
||||
- Both GitLab instances have [migration enabled in application settings](../../admin_area/settings/visibility_and_access_controls.md#enable-migration-of-groups-and-projects-by-direct-transfer) by instance administrator.
|
||||
- Owner role on the top-level group to migrate.
|
||||
|
||||
WARNING:
|
||||
|
|
@ -56,8 +61,6 @@ You can migrate:
|
|||
- By direct transfer using either the UI or the [API](../../../api/bulk_imports.md).
|
||||
- Many groups at once.
|
||||
|
||||
When migrating a top-level group to GitLab.com, all its subgroups and projects are migrated too.
|
||||
|
||||
Not all group and project resources are imported. See list of migrated resources below:
|
||||
|
||||
- [Migrated group items](#migrated-group-items).
|
||||
|
|
|
|||
|
|
@ -68,6 +68,8 @@ GitLab content imports that use GitHub accounts require that the GitHub public-f
|
|||
all comments and contributions are properly mapped to the same user in GitLab. GitHub Enterprise does not require this
|
||||
field to be populated so you may have to add it on existing accounts.
|
||||
|
||||
See also [Branch protection rules and project settings](#branch-protection-rules-and-project-settings) for additional prerequisites for those imports.
|
||||
|
||||
## Import your GitHub repository into GitLab
|
||||
|
||||
### Use the GitHub integration
|
||||
|
|
@ -247,7 +249,10 @@ When they are imported, supported GitHub branch protection rules are mapped to e
|
|||
| **Require signed commits** for the project's default branch | **Reject unsigned commits** GitLab [push rule](../repository/push_rules.md#prevent-unintended-consequences) **(PREMIUM)** | [GitLab 15.5](https://gitlab.com/gitlab-org/gitlab/-/issues/370949) |
|
||||
| **Allow force pushes - Everyone** | **Allowed to force push** [branch protection setting](../protected_branches.md#allow-force-push-on-a-protected-branch) | [GitLab 15.6](https://gitlab.com/gitlab-org/gitlab/-/issues/370943) |
|
||||
| **Require a pull request before merging - Require review from Code Owners** | **Require approval from code owners** [branch protection setting](../protected_branches.md#require-code-owner-approval-on-a-protected-branch) **(PREMIUM)** | [GitLab 15.6](https://gitlab.com/gitlab-org/gitlab/-/issues/376683) |
|
||||
| **Require a pull request before merging - Allow specified actors to bypass required pull requests** | List of users in the **Allowed to push** list of [branch protection settings](../protected_branches.md#configure-a-protected-branch) **(PREMIUM)** | [GitLab 15.8](https://gitlab.com/gitlab-org/gitlab/-/issues/384939) |
|
||||
| **Require a pull request before merging - Allow specified actors to bypass required pull requests** (1) | List of users in the **Allowed to push** list of [branch protection settings](../protected_branches.md#configure-a-protected-branch) **(PREMIUM)**. Without a Premium license, the list of users that are allowed to push is limited to roles. | [GitLab 15.8](https://gitlab.com/gitlab-org/gitlab/-/issues/384939) |
|
||||
|
||||
1. To successfully import the **Require a pull request before merging - Allow specified actors to bypass required pull requests** rule, you must add to the parent group in GitLab
|
||||
the users that are allowed to bypass required pull requests before you begin importing.
|
||||
|
||||
Mapping GitHub rule **Require status checks to pass before merging** to
|
||||
[external status checks](../merge_requests/status_checks.md) was considered in issue
|
||||
|
|
|
|||
|
|
@ -16285,12 +16285,18 @@ msgstr ""
|
|||
msgid "EscalationPolicies|Are you sure you want to delete the \"%{escalationPolicy}\" escalation policy? This action cannot be undone."
|
||||
msgstr ""
|
||||
|
||||
msgid "EscalationPolicies|Choose who to email if those contacted first about an alert don't respond."
|
||||
msgstr ""
|
||||
|
||||
msgid "EscalationPolicies|Create an escalation policy in GitLab"
|
||||
msgstr ""
|
||||
|
||||
msgid "EscalationPolicies|Delete escalation policy"
|
||||
msgstr ""
|
||||
|
||||
msgid "EscalationPolicies|Distinguishes this policy from others you may create (for example, \"Critical alert escalation\")."
|
||||
msgstr ""
|
||||
|
||||
msgid "EscalationPolicies|Edit escalation policy"
|
||||
msgstr ""
|
||||
|
||||
|
|
@ -16306,6 +16312,9 @@ msgstr ""
|
|||
msgid "EscalationPolicies|Escalation policy %{obstacle} in project %{project}"
|
||||
msgstr ""
|
||||
|
||||
msgid "EscalationPolicies|Escalation policy successfully created"
|
||||
msgstr ""
|
||||
|
||||
msgid "EscalationPolicies|Escalation rules"
|
||||
msgstr ""
|
||||
|
||||
|
|
@ -16321,6 +16330,9 @@ msgstr ""
|
|||
msgid "EscalationPolicies|Minutes must be between 0 and 1440."
|
||||
msgstr ""
|
||||
|
||||
msgid "EscalationPolicies|More detailed information about your policy."
|
||||
msgstr ""
|
||||
|
||||
msgid "EscalationPolicies|Remove escalation rule"
|
||||
msgstr ""
|
||||
|
||||
|
|
@ -16330,9 +16342,6 @@ msgstr ""
|
|||
msgid "EscalationPolicies|Select schedule"
|
||||
msgstr ""
|
||||
|
||||
msgid "EscalationPolicies|Set up escalation policies to define who is paged, and when, in the event the first users paged don't respond."
|
||||
msgstr ""
|
||||
|
||||
msgid "EscalationPolicies|THEN %{doAction} %{scheduleOrUser}"
|
||||
msgstr ""
|
||||
|
||||
|
|
@ -16345,6 +16354,9 @@ msgstr ""
|
|||
msgid "EscalationPolicies|This policy has no escalation rules."
|
||||
msgstr ""
|
||||
|
||||
msgid "EscalationPolicies|When a new alert is received, the users specified in the policy receive an email."
|
||||
msgstr ""
|
||||
|
||||
msgid "EscalationPolicies|mins"
|
||||
msgstr ""
|
||||
|
||||
|
|
|
|||
|
|
@ -7,7 +7,7 @@ require (
|
|||
github.com/BurntSushi/toml v1.2.1
|
||||
github.com/FZambia/sentinel v1.1.1
|
||||
github.com/alecthomas/chroma/v2 v2.4.0
|
||||
github.com/aws/aws-sdk-go v1.44.167
|
||||
github.com/aws/aws-sdk-go v1.44.180
|
||||
github.com/disintegration/imaging v1.6.2
|
||||
github.com/getsentry/raven-go v0.2.0
|
||||
github.com/golang-jwt/jwt/v4 v4.4.3
|
||||
|
|
|
|||
|
|
@ -228,8 +228,8 @@ github.com/aws/aws-sdk-go v1.43.11/go.mod h1:y4AeaBuwd2Lk+GepC1E9v0qOiTws0MIWAX4
|
|||
github.com/aws/aws-sdk-go v1.43.31/go.mod h1:y4AeaBuwd2Lk+GepC1E9v0qOiTws0MIWAX4oIKwKHZo=
|
||||
github.com/aws/aws-sdk-go v1.44.45/go.mod h1:y4AeaBuwd2Lk+GepC1E9v0qOiTws0MIWAX4oIKwKHZo=
|
||||
github.com/aws/aws-sdk-go v1.44.68/go.mod h1:y4AeaBuwd2Lk+GepC1E9v0qOiTws0MIWAX4oIKwKHZo=
|
||||
github.com/aws/aws-sdk-go v1.44.167 h1:kQmBhGdZkQLU7AiHShSkBJ15zr8agy0QeaxXduvyp2E=
|
||||
github.com/aws/aws-sdk-go v1.44.167/go.mod h1:aVsgQcEevwlmQ7qHE9I3h+dtQgpqhFB+i8Phjh7fkwI=
|
||||
github.com/aws/aws-sdk-go v1.44.180 h1:VLZuAHI9fa/3WME5JjpVjcPCNfpGHVMiHx8sLHWhMgI=
|
||||
github.com/aws/aws-sdk-go v1.44.180/go.mod h1:aVsgQcEevwlmQ7qHE9I3h+dtQgpqhFB+i8Phjh7fkwI=
|
||||
github.com/aws/aws-sdk-go-v2 v0.18.0/go.mod h1:JWVYvqSMppoMJC0x5wdwiImzgXTI9FuZwxzkQq9wy+g=
|
||||
github.com/aws/aws-sdk-go-v2 v1.16.8 h1:gOe9UPR98XSf7oEJCcojYg+N2/jCRm4DdeIsP85pIyQ=
|
||||
github.com/aws/aws-sdk-go-v2 v1.16.8/go.mod h1:6CpKuLXg2w7If3ABZCl/qZ6rEgwtjZTn4eAf4RcEyuw=
|
||||
|
|
|
|||
Loading…
Reference in New Issue